Astros Rookie Throws First No-Hitter
from Houston Astros News Today | 2 Minute News | The Daily News Now!
Houston Astros stunned the Texas Rangers with a historic no-hitter Monday night, powered by rookie pitcher Tatsuya Imai and capped by Alimber Santa—making his MLB debut unforgettable as the final pitcher. The Astros’ offense added two home runs to seal a 9-0 victory, extending their winning streak to four games. This marks the 17th no-hitter in Astros history and the first in MLB this season, highlighting their dominant pitching staff, which has thrown three of the last seven no-hitters in the league.
